The global antibody drug conjugates market is undergoing remarkable growth, transforming the oncology treatment landscape with its precision-based therapeutic approach. Valued at USD 12.29 billion in 2024, the market is expected to reach an impressive USD 29.10 billion by 2032, expanding at a CAGR of 12.29% during the forecast period (2025–2032). This surge underscores the increasing adoption of ADCs as the next frontier in targeted cancer treatment, combining the selectivity of monoclonal antibodies with the potency of cytotoxic agents.

Driving Forces Behind Market Growth

The primary catalyst fueling the ADC market is the rising demand for targeted cancer therapies. Traditional chemotherapy, though effective, often leads to severe side effects due to its impact on healthy cells. ADCs are designed to address this limitation by delivering cytotoxic drugs directly to tumor cells, sparing surrounding healthy tissues and improving patient outcomes.

Key Market Developments

Recent collaborations, acquisitions, and product launches highlight the industry’s dynamic progression:

  • Johnson & Johnson’s acquisition of Ambrx Biopharma (January 2024): Aimed at leveraging Ambrx’s proprietary ADC technology for prostate cancer treatments, this move strengthens J&J’s oncology pipeline.
  • Celltrion and WuXi XDC partnership (early 2024): Focused on accelerating ADC development and manufacturing capabilities, this collaboration marks a strategic step in addressing global therapeutic demand.
  • Investments by top players: Leading firms such as Gilead Sciences, Bristol Myers Squibb, and AstraZeneca are allocating significant resources to expand their ADC portfolios.

Market Segmentation Insights

The ADC market is segmented based on application, product, target, and technology, providing a comprehensive understanding of its diverse opportunities:

  1. By Application
  • Blood Cancer
  • Breast Cancer
  • Urothelial Cancer & Bladder Cancer
  • Other Cancers

Breast cancer and hematological malignancies currently dominate the application segment due to high prevalence rates and established product pipelines.

  1. By Product
  • Kadcyla
  • Enhertu
  • Adcetris
  • Padcev
  • Trodelvy
  • Polivy
  • Others

Blockbuster drugs like Kadcyla and Enhertu continue to lead the market, with next-generation entrants expected to capture substantial market share.

  1. By Target
  • HER2
  • CD22
  • CD30
  • Others

HER2-targeted ADCs remain a cornerstone of breast cancer treatment, while CD22 and CD30 targets are gaining traction in hematological oncology.

  1. By Technology
  • Technology Type
  • Linker Technology Type
  • Payload Technology

Innovations in linker chemistry are crucial for enhancing drug stability, ensuring precise payload release at the tumor site.
